Aloft London Excel
Starwood Hotels and Resorts worldwide is one of the leading hotel and leisure companies in the world with approximately 1000 properties in more than 95 countries and 145000 employees at its owned and managed properties.
The brand landed in Europe with the Aloft Brussels Schuman in 2010 and is the fasted brand launched ever.
Aloft is part of Starwood Hotels and Resorts and has been opened on 3rd of October 2011.
The hotel has 252 guestrooms including 12 suites, 181 King Aloft guestrooms and 50 Double queen Aloft guestrooms, a Swimming Pool and Gym .Aloft is part of a modern 100 acre campus, located 10 minutes from Canary Warf, in the heart of London’s Royal Docks. Including onsite parking, 3 DLR (Docklands Light Railway) stations, with easy access to the Jubilee Line, central London and 5 minutes away from London City International Airport.

    Starwood Hotels is one the largest hotel companies in the world. At the end or 2010, their chain comprised 1,027 hotels with approximately 302,000 rooms in nearly 100 countries. The hotels were either owned or leased (62 properties), managed on a hotel management contract (463) or franchised hotels (502 properties). Over half their hotels are in North America and the Caribbean and one quarter in Europe, Middle East and Africa (EMEA). Most of their brands are in the upper end of the market, and include St. Regis, W, Westin, Le Meridien, and Sheraton. This market position means that the chain has focused on quality and was an early adopter of six sigma amongst service firms in 2001. Between 2001 and 2006 the company reported that it had delivered $100 million of extra profit from its Six Sigma initiative and that this explained why its net margin was 15% higher than its two main rivals - Hilton and Marriott.…

    Starwood was founded by Mr. Barry S. Sternlicht in 1991. At the beginning the company only owned some hotels with different brand names in North America. In 1994 the Westin Hotel Company was bought. Four years later Starwood made a big step to become one of the largest and most successful hotel chains in the world by getting the rights for the hotel brand Sheraton. Only twelve month later, namely in 1999, the W-hotels were created. In 2005 Starwood founded the brand Aloft and bought the brand Le Meridien (Press, 2003). All in all, the company owns nine different brands, which are Sheraton, Arabella Starwood, Westin, Le Meridien, The Luxury Collection, St. Regis, W Hotels, Aloft and Element.
